Applicable Legal Framework

This policy is governed by Colombian personal data protection law:

  • Ley 1581 de 2012 — Personal Data Protection Law (LEPD)
  • Decreto 1377 de 2013 — Partial regulation of Ley 1581
  • Decreto 886 de 2014 — National Database Registry (RNBD)
  • Ley 1266 de 2008 — Financial Habeas Data
  • Colombia's Constitution, Article 15 — the right to privacy and Habeas Data

Data Subject Rights (ARCOP)

As the owner of your personal data, you have the following rights under Article 8 of Ley 1581 de 2012:

A Access Know what data we hold about you and how it's processed.
R Rectification Request correction of inaccurate, incomplete, or outdated data.
C Cancellation / Deletion Request removal of your data when no longer necessary for the stated purpose.
O Objection Object to the processing of your data for specific purposes.
P Portability Receive your data in a structured, commonly-used format, when technically possible.

To exercise any of these rights, email us at [email protected] with the subject line "ARCOP Rights Request". We will respond within a maximum of 10 business days, in accordance with Article 22 of Ley 1581 de 2012.

Supervisory Authority

In Colombia, the entity responsible for enforcing Ley 1581 de 2012 is the Superintendencia de Industria y Comercio (SIC) — Colombia's data protection authority. If you believe your rights have not been properly addressed, you may file a complaint with:
